Job Description:

We are looking for a knowledgeable Payroll Specialist to process and manage the company’s payroll. You will be the one to calculate wages based on hours worked and administer payments. A payroll specialist is able to use payroll software with accuracy and efficiency and is good with numbers and can be trusted with sensitive information.

Responsibilities:

• Knowledge expertise of regulations around employee payroll.

• Monitor and understand US federal, state, and local tax laws to ensure compliance.

• Perform regular audits to identify and resolve compliance issues, avoid delays in filings to monitor penalties/ notices.

• Work in partnership with the Payroll Team to ensure accurate and timely processing of payroll tax liabilities.

• Reconcile federal state withholding taxes and unemployment taxes monthly, quarterly, and annually.

• Partnering with internal stakeholders and UKG to apply for identification numbers, such as FEIN, and SUI, when entering new jurisdictions.

• Evaluate and improve payroll tax processes with higher efficiency and accuracy. Also, Identify opportunities for automation and lead implementation efforts from payroll taxes.

• Coordinate year-end efforts to ensure accurate W-2s and other annual tax filings

• Ensure proper setup and maintenance of local withholding codes for employer and employees in the UKG payroll system
